Matt One simple and (more importantly) cheap upgrade is something known as "The big three". It involves replacing a few factory cables (3!!) with something more substantial. The ground wire between the battery and the car chassis. Replace this with at least a 4awg gauge cable. Change the charging wire between the battery and the alternator, again with at least a 4awg cable. (Only applicable if your car has one!) Replace the alternator chassis ground cable with 4awg cable.
